Pixie Renderer features and specs

  • Open Source
    Pixie Renderer is open source, allowing users to modify and extend its code base to suit their needs without any licensing costs.
  • REYES Rendering Algorithm
    Implements the robust and efficient REYES algorithm, which is great for handling complex scenes by breaking them down into micro-polygons.
  • Compatibility with RenderMan
    Pixie is compatible with the RenderMan standard, enabling it to work with numerous assets and plugins developed for RenderMan.
  • Shader Language Support
    Supports a shader language that allows for the creation of complex surface and displacement shaders, providing flexibility in rendering effects.
